She is listed in Debrett as the daughter of the first Viscount Donerail. Her husband publishes On the Terms of Peace with Russia, 1856. His nephew places a memorial stone to him in the church dedicated to St Andrew that he builds at Kingswood: 'The other memorial, on the north wall of the chancel, is dedicated to Lieut. Col. Thomas Alcock, who at an advanced age was asked by his nephew to lay the first stone of St. Andrew's in 1848 and was still there to celebrate its consecration 4 years later. Note at the bottom of the memorial the impaled arms of Alcock and St Leger'.

Inscription

SACRED TO THE MEMORY/ OF THE HONORABLE/ CAROLINE CATHERINE LETITIA ALCOCK/ WIFE OF LT COLONEL THOS ALCOCK/ AND SISTER OF THE LATE HAYES ST LEGER/ VISCOUNT DONERAIL OF DONERAIL IRELAND/ WHO DEPARTED THIS LIFE ON THE 1ST OF/ FEBRUARY 1840 AGED 66/ 190
